Why a Side Discharge Lawn Mower Is Necessary
I find a side discharge lawn mower necessary because it helps me mow faster, especially when the grass is long or a little wet. Instead of stopping to empty a bag, the mower throws the clippings out to the side, which saves me time and keeps my work moving smoothly. For larger yards, this makes a big difference in how quickly I can finish.
My experience is that side discharge mowers also handle thick grass better. When the grass is heavy, bagging can slow the mower down and make it work harder. With side discharge, the clippings spread out more naturally, so I get a cleaner cut without putting extra strain on the machine.
I also like that the clippings can act as a natural mulch. When they fall back onto the lawn, they can help return nutrients to the soil and reduce the need for extra fertilizing. For me, that makes side discharge not just practical, but also a smart choice for keeping my lawn healthy.
My Buying Guides on Side Discharge Lawn Mower
What I Look for First
When I shop for a side discharge lawn mower, I first think about my yard size and grass type. For a small, flat lawn, I do not need the most powerful model. For a larger yard or thicker grass, I look for a mower with more cutting strength and a wider deck so I can finish faster.
Why I Choose Side Discharge
I like side discharge mowers because they spread clippings back onto the lawn instead of collecting them in a bag. This saves me time and keeps mowing simple. I also find it useful when the grass is a little taller, since side discharge handles heavy cutting better than some other options.
Power Source Matters to Me
I usually decide between gas, corded electric, and battery-powered models. Gas mowers give me more power and longer run time, which helps on bigger lawns. Battery mowers are quieter and easier to maintain, while corded electric mowers work well for small yards if I do not mind staying near an outlet.
Cutting Width and Height Adjustment
I pay attention to cutting width because it affects how quickly I can mow. A wider deck covers more ground, but it can be harder to move in tight spaces. I also make sure the mower has easy height adjustment so I can change the cutting level depending on the season and grass condition.
Build Quality and Durability
I prefer a mower with a strong steel or high-quality composite deck. A durable build gives me confidence that the mower will last through regular use. I also check the wheels, handle, and overall frame because these parts affect how smooth and stable the mower feels.
Ease of Use and Comfort
I always consider how comfortable the mower is to push or drive. A lightweight mower is easier for me to handle, especially on slopes or uneven ground. I also like features such as foldable handles, easy-start systems, and simple controls because they make mowing less tiring.
Maintenance Needs
I try to choose a mower that is easy to maintain. With gas models, I think about oil changes, spark plugs, and air filters. With battery and electric models, I focus more on keeping the blades sharp and the mower clean. A mower that is simple to care for saves me time in the long run.
Safety Features I Check
I look for safety features like blade stop systems, sturdy guards, and reliable controls. These features help me feel more secure while mowing. I also make sure the mower has a design that reduces the chance of debris being thrown in an unsafe direction.
My Final Buying Tip
Before I buy, I compare price, performance, and comfort together instead of focusing on just one feature. The best side discharge lawn mower for me is the one that matches my yard, my budget, and how often I mow. When I choose carefully, I get a mower that makes lawn care easier and faster.
